Cardinal Edmund Szoka, former Vatican City governor, head of Detroit archdiocese, dies at 86


DETROIT – Cardinal Edmund Szoka (SHAHK'-uh), the former governor of Vatican City and the head of the Detroit archdiocese, has died. He was 86. The Archdiocese of Detroit says Szoka died of natural causes Wednesday night at Providence Park Hospital in ...

Bank of America agrees to nearly $17B settlement


Bank of America agrees to nearly $17B settlement WASHINGTON (AP) — The government has reached a $16.65 billion settlement with Bank of America over its role in the sale of mortgage-backed securities in the run-up to the financial crisis, the Justice Department announced Thursday.
